MahaRERA issues notices to 261 projects with slow progress

Mumbai: Maharashtra Real Estate Regulatory Authority (Maharera) has issued show cause notices to 261 projects in which less than 40% work has been completed, while the possession of flats has been promised by December 2023.

There are a total of 45,539 flats in all the projects, out of which 26,178 flats have been booked by home buyers. MahaRERA has issued these notices only on the basis of the information submitted by the developers.

The regulatory authority has been examining projects registered with it as part of its monitoring exercise. The show cause notices to the developers have been issued by MahaRERA to find out how the developers intend to complete these projects in the next nine months.

The promoters have been given 15 days to respond. Of the 261 projects, 26 are from Mumbai city and 94 are from Mumbai suburbs, 43 from Mumbai Thanesince 15 RaigadSix from Palghar and 67 from Palghar Pune,
